Staff Veterinarian – Trauma Hospital The Arizona Humane Society is a nationally recognized leader in animal welfare, caring for nearly 25,000 pets each year. Since 1957, we've been driven by the belief that every pet deserves a good life, and we are passionately committed to doing what's best for pets and the people in their lives. This position is at our state-of-the-art Papago Park Campus which opened in 2024 and pays $120,000+ depending upon skills and experience. If you are an energetic Veterinarian with at least 2-3 years of experience, including surgical and dental, looking to make a difference in a mission-driven organization, we'd love to hear from you. A Day in the Life: Oversee the treatment of animals, including those that are sick, injured, and abused and are brought in by our nationally recognized Emergency Animal Medical Technicians. Administer excellent patient care in a well-equipped trauma hospital with in-house lab equipment, digital x-ray, and ultrasound. Perform physical exams, diagnostics, therapeutics, and determine appropriate disposition for animals. Treat shelter animals, including general surgery, dentistry, and spay/neuter. Provide accurate care instructions to a team of veterinary technicians. Serve as a positive leader and promote a professional image through interactions with employees, donors, stakeholders and the media.

Requirements

  • Doctor of Veterinary Medicine or Veterinary Medical Doctor Degree and license to practice in Arizona (or ability to obtain AZ license).
  • Active DEA license required.
  • 2-3 years of experience in a veterinary practice required.
  • Must work well in a team environment and provide exceptional customer service internally and externally.
  • Language Skills: Able to speak, read and write English; Spanish language helpful.
  • Mathematical Skills: Understanding of retail and cash handling operations required.
  • Computer Skills: Proficiency with Microsoft Word, PowerPoint, Excel, Outlook, and Explorer; able to learn other software programs as necessary.
  • Proficiency with or ability to learn/use Chameleon software (for use with animals in a shelter environment).

Nice To Haves

  • Experience working in an animal shelter preferred.
  • Above average surgical and dental skills preferred.
  • Orthopedic surgical skills a plus.
